Predynastic to Early Dynastic Period, Ca. 3100 - 2686 BC.
A pair of tall Egyptian alabaster jugs with round feet and conical bodies, both connected to a short and out curving rim. For similar see: Christie's, live auction 6060, Antiquities , Lot. 126.
Size: 170-170mm x 70-70mm; Weight: 570g
Provenance: Property of a West London gentleman; previously in a collection formed on the UK/International art market in the 1990s. This item has been cleared against the Art Loss Register database and comes with a confirmation letter.
